Vasalund - BK Forward 1 - 0

Ettan Norra 2022


Vasalund - BK Forward (1 - 0)
Match in Ettan Norra 2022
Match start: 2022-09-17 at 13:00
Venue: Skytteholms IP 1
Attendance: 523


Vasalund defeated BK Forward 1-0 in Saturday's match at Skytteholms IP 1. The match began with a warning for BK Forward after 15 minutes, and it took only four more minutes before Victor Söderström gave Vasalund the lead. After that, the game continued with intense play, and Nicolas Gianini Dantas received a yellow card for Vasalund in the 58th minute.

BK Forward brought on Marcus Kanto after 65 minutes, but it did not help against Vasalund's defense. Instead, Vasalund made three substitutions after the 69th minute to try to maintain their lead. Adam Id Salem and Ludvig Öhman Silwerfeldt received yellow cards in the 79th and 81st minutes respectively for Vasalund, but it did not help BK Forward. They made two substitutions in the 82nd minute, but Vasalund held on until the end.

The final minutes of the match were intense, and Vasalund substituted Edmond Gukasian in the 90th minute to try to preserve their lead. Babar Rehman, who was the contact person for Vasalund during the match, received a yellow card in the second minute of stoppage time for time played after the regular match time. In the end, it was Vasalund who won the match, and they continue to climb the table.
